Nice layout

It has been a while since I skied at Breckenridge but here are some of what I remember:

The layout of the trails is particularly nice. The peaks are separate but they have a good system (with great signs) for getting between them.

I spent my time at Breckenridge on the blues and found there to be enough variety and a large enough mountain to spread skiers out and avoid crowds. Try to get away from the village for the least crowds.

Fun, well-planned intermediate terrain

I was at Breckenridge 2 years ago, when I was barely an intermediate skier. From that perspective, I had a really good time. Peak 7 was *a lot* of fun - nice, rolling blue cruisers that get re-groomed at noon, perfect for learning to carve and just having fun. Also, you have to take a relatively flat catwalk to get there, so it's comparatively less crowded than the rest of the mountain and snowboarders are rare.

I also really enjoyed Peak 9, though when I was there it got pretty icy by the end of the day. Makes sense, though, given that it's very accessible and full of intermediate skiers/riders.

I look forward to heading back to Breckenridge to try some of the harder stuff, particularly the new Imperial chair.
